Etymology[edit]
Attested as Lange weg in 1866. Compound of lang (“long”) and the diminutive form of weg (“way, road”).
See also Zealandic 't Langweegje.
Pronunciation[edit]
- IPA(key): /ˌlɑ.ŋəˈʋeːx.jə/
- Hyphenation: Lan‧ge‧weeg‧je
- Rhymes: -eːxjə
Proper noun[edit]
Langeweegje n
- A hamlet in Borsele, Zeeland, Netherlands.
